程式碼
WordPress.com 大多數網站都使用共用環境,這也表示所有網站都是在同一套軟體上運作;這樣的好處是我們可以同時更新數百萬個網站賴以運作的程式碼,也能夠快速修復錯誤,或提供新功能。這對使用者來說好處很多。
HTML 標籤
JavaScript
Flash 和其他嵌入資源
發佈原始碼
商用版或電子商務版方案
但使用同一套軟體,同時維持多個網站的運作,可能也很危險;一個不小心,某個網站內的錯誤,就可能摧毀整個 WordPress.com,讓其他網站也無法正常連線。因此,我們必須限制你在網站發佈的某些內容,以免對整個 WordPress.com 造成影響。
如果你在網站裡寫了一些程式碼,或從其他網站複製貼上,發佈文章後,程式碼卻不見了,有可能是因為安全理由而遭刪除。如果你認為程式碼遭不當刪除,或想建議我們應該開放某些程式碼類型,請聯絡支援團隊。
如果你想在網站內撰寫程式碼,不妨考慮使用 WordPress.com 商用版或電子商務版方案;按此處以深入了解商用版或電子商務版方案提供的程式碼新增功能。
HTML 標籤
WordPress.com 可讓你在文章、頁面和小工具中使用以下 HTML 標籤:
- a
- address
- abbr
- acronym
- area
- article
- aside
- b
- big
- blockquote
- br
- caption
- cite
- class
- code
- col
- del
- details
- dd
- div
- dl
- dt
- em
- figure
- figcaption
- footer
- font
- h1, h2, h3, h4, h5, h6
- header
- hgroup
- i
- img
- ins
- kbd
- li
- map
- mark
- ol
- p
- pre
- q
- rp
- rt
- rtc
- ruby
- s
- section
- small
- span
- strike
- strong
- sub
- summar
- sup
- table
- tbody
- td
- tfoot
- th
- thead
- tr
- tt
- u
- ul
- var
某些佈景主題的標題支援下列標籤:
a, abbr, b, cite, del, em, i, q, s, strong, strike, u
查看 W3 Schools,深入了解如何使用這些 HTML 程式碼。
為了安全起見,進階版及更低階方案的網站,皆無法使用以下標籤:
embed, frame, iframe, form, input, object, textarea, style
安裝了外掛程式的商用版方案網站,將有機會使用這些標籤。
JavaScript
- 安裝了外掛程式的商用版方案網站,可以在網站上使用 JavaScript 程式碼。
- 為了安全起見,進階版及更低階方案的網站,皆無法發佈 JavaScript 程式碼。
- 這是因為 JavaScript 可能被惡意濫用;過去 JavaScript 曾導致 MySpace.com 和 LiveJournal 等網站發生嚴重當站。
- 我們最重視所有 WordPress.com 網站的安全性;若無法確認指令碼語言具有絕對安全性,我們就不會開放使用指令碼程式語言的使用。
YouTube 和 Google Video 等受信任合作夥伴的 JavaScript 程式碼,在儲存文章時會自動轉換為 WordPress 短代碼。
Flash 和其他嵌入資源
使用進階版及更低階方案的 WordPress.com 網站,皆無法使用 Flash 和其他使用下列標籤的嵌入資源類型:
embed, frame, iframe, form, input, object, textarea
有多種方法可以將影片、音訊和其他多媒體項目安全地發佈到任何 WordPress.com 網站。此外,嵌入內容頁面也會列出各種允許的嵌入資源類型。只有商用版或更高階方案的 WordPress.com 網站,允許使用可能含有危險 HTML 標籤的 Flash 和其他嵌入資源類型。
發表原始碼
如需深入了解如何在網誌內輕鬆發表程式原始碼,請參閱我們的發佈原始碼文章。
商用版、電子商務版方案
- 上述程式碼限制僅適用於免費版、個人版和進階版方案。
- 若使用 WordPress.com 商用版和電子商務版方案,你可以選擇安裝第三方外掛程式和佈景主題。
- 自訂外掛程式和佈景主題通常容易遭受惡意攻擊,所以如果選擇安裝這些工具,我們會將你的網站與共用的 WordPress.com 環境區隔開來。
- 我們也會在幕後大幅調整基礎架構,以保障你的網站安全。
經過這些調整,只要你在商用版或電子商務版方案網站安裝自訂外掛程式或佈景主題,就可以在網站任何位置隨意新增所需程式碼,JavaScript、Flash,每一種都可以正常使用!
不過新增自訂程式碼時請格外小心。由於你的網站已與共用環境區隔開來,攻擊者無法惡意利用它來攻擊其他 WordPress.com 網站,但你的網站本身仍可能容易遭受攻擊。因此建議你只新增來源可信賴的程式碼。如果有任何疑慮,最好還是不要冒險安裝。
Still confused?
Help us improve:
We're always looking to improve our documentation. If this page didn't answer your question or left you wanting more, let us know! We love hearing your feedback. For support, please use the forums or contact support form. Thanks!